Why networks are layered ? What is the advantage of that ?

anyway based on the reply on that post there are 3 reasons

1. When a system is visualized in layers then u are free to
make changes in any one layer and be assured that other
layers are not affected

2. It makes troubleshooting simple

3. Layered models give a general idea of the functions of
the layers giving freedom to vendors to bring in their own
innovation otherwise the whole system can be monopolised by
a single vendor...
